Rotary to hold free legal clinic at SM City

DO YOU have legal woes?

The Rotary Club of Bacolod South is set to hold a one-day legal consultation on Saturday from 1 p.m. to 5 p.m. on the second floor of SM City Bacolod’s north wing.

Club president Jumar Dennis Encabo said that this project, in partnership with the Integrated Bar of the Philippines–Negros Occidental and SM City Bacolod, is a continuing advocacy to bring legal advice and services to the public, most especially those who need it.

“Lawyers’ fees usually start at P500 to P1,000 and can add up, discouraging many to approach lawyers. So, in our effort to help those in need of legal help, we have a free legal consultation program. As I understand, it is only RCBS who conducts free legal clinic among the Rotary clubs here in Bacolod,” Encabo said.

There is no limit to the topics of interest that IBP participating lawyers can cover but clients may also be advised if a particular case cannot be entertained due to conflict or any other reason.

Encabo also extended his club’s thanks to the local IBP headed by Arnel Lapore for enjoining fellow lawyers to be part of this social responsibility project. “We anticipate a good number of legal counselors available on Saturday afternoon so we call on the public to take advantage of their free services.” (PR)
